如何停止Shadowsocks服务

在网络安全和隐私日益受到重视的今天,Shadowsocks成为了很多用户进行网络加密和科学上网的重要工具。然而,有时候用户可能需要停止Shadowsocks服务。本文将详细介绍如何在不同操作系统下停止Shadowsocks服务,并解答相关的常见问题。

一、了解Shadowsocks

1. 什么是Shadowsocks?

Shadowsocks是一款开源的代理工具,主要用于绕过互联网审查。它通过加密用户的网络流量来保护隐私,同时也能加速用户的网络访问。

2. 为什么要停止Shadowsocks服务?

用户可能出于以下原因需要停止Shadowsocks服务:

  • 需要恢复正常的网络连接
  • 遇到网络故障或异常
  • 更新或重启服务
  • 临时不再使用代理服务

二、在Windows系统下停止Shadowsocks服务

1. 通过界面停止服务

  • 找到Shadowsocks的托盘图标
  • 右键点击图标
  • 选择“退出”或“停止服务”

2. 通过命令行停止服务

如果你是在Windows系统下运行Shadowsocks,你可以通过命令行来停止服务:

  • 按下Win + R键,输入cmd,然后按下Enter

  • 在命令提示符中输入以下命令:
    shell taskkill /F /IM shadowsocks.exe

  • 按下Enter后,Shadowsocks服务将被强制停止。

三、在macOS系统下停止Shadowsocks服务

1. 通过界面停止服务

  • 找到菜单栏中的Shadowsocks图标
  • 点击该图标
  • 选择“退出”或“停止服务”

2. 通过终端停止服务

  • 打开终端应用

  • 输入以下命令:
    shell killall shadowsocks

  • 按下Enter后,Shadowsocks服务将被终止。

四、在Linux系统下停止Shadowsocks服务

1. 使用systemctl停止服务

如果你是在Linux系统下以服务的形式运行Shadowsocks,可以使用以下命令:

  • 打开终端

  • 输入:
    shell sudo systemctl stop shadowsocks

  • 输入你的用户密码,按下Enter,Shadowsocks服务将停止。

2. 通过pkill命令停止服务

  • 在终端输入:
    shell pkill -f shadowsocks

  • 按下Enter,即可终止所有Shadowsocks相关的进程。

五、在Android和iOS上停止Shadowsocks服务

1. 在Android设备上停止服务

  • 打开Shadowsocks应用
  • 点击连接按钮,切换为未连接状态
  • 或者在设置中选择“停止服务”

2. 在iOS设备上停止服务

  • 打开Shadowsocks应用
  • 点击“断开连接”按钮即可停止服务

六、常见问题解答(FAQ)

1. 为什么我无法停止Shadowsocks服务?

可能是因为权限问题,确保你以管理员身份运行应用或命令。

2. 停止Shadowsocks后会影响网络连接吗?

是的,停止Shadowsocks后,所有网络流量将不再经过代理,恢复为正常的网络连接。

3. 如何确保Shadowsocks服务已成功停止?

你可以检查任务管理器(Windows)或活动监视器(macOS),确认shadowsocks进程是否已结束。

4. Shadowsocks停止服务后,如何重新连接?

只需再次打开Shadowsocks应用,并点击连接按钮即可重新连接。

七、注意事项

  • 停止Shadowsocks服务后,务必确认其他网络安全工具是否正常工作
  • 建议在使用公共Wi-Fi时保持使用代理服务,以确保网络安全
  • 停止服务后,可以考虑对设备进行全面的网络安全检查

通过本文的指导,您应该能够顺利地停止Shadowsocks服务,确保在需要时可以快速切换网络状态。

正文完